In this final podcast episode, hear from Hu Jun and Tou Chen about why they decided to become Singaporeans and how they perceive their Chinese Singaporean identity, in light of their ties with China and Malaysia.
TALK LEH! Is a video podcast series that seeks to hear from Singaporean Chinese on their views towards their own identity, while exploring unique factors that intersect one’s Singaporean Chinese identity.

I couldn’t agree more with what Hu Jun and Tou Chen mentioned. Both the migrant worker instance during Covid and the HDB and PR application experience that Hu Jun went through really says a lot about how much the Singapore government is doing for its people, just as what the national pledge of Singapore mentioned, “pledge ourselves as one united people”, “regardless of race, language or religion”, and “to build a democratic society based on justice and equality”. I think this is also one of the reasons why we can identity ourselves as Chinese Singaporean and not just Chinese or Singaporean. As Chinese, we have traditional Chinese values that we hold close, at the same time some Chinese practices or traditions have evolved into something that’s uniquely local, and that’s because of our multiculturalism and our unity as a country. For example, Chinese New Year goodies that Singaporeans enjoy such as Kueh Bangkit and Kuih Bahulu did not originate from Chinese or China, but rather from Malay. Nonetheless we identify them with Chinese New Year, and that’s exactly what makes us uniquely Chinese Singaporean.
